XCS: A Serendipitous Galaxy Cluster Survey with XMM-Newton.

Nichol, Kathy RomerKathy Romer, Pedro Viana, Michael WestThis poster contribution outlines XCS, a major serendipitous galaxy cluster survey that we intend to undertake using archival data taken by ESA's XMM-Newton X-ray satellite: further details can be found at the XCS WWW site (www.xcs-home.org) and in Romer et al. (2000). We describe the principal science drivers for cluster surveys, discuss the motivation for the XCS project design, and present our expectations for the properties of the catalogue resulting from XCS.
